This book is written for the layperson in clear, easy-to-understand terms to assist homeowners in understanding why some soils and conditions can lead to structural or cosmetic damage to buildings. Both the nature of the soil behavior and how buildings respond are addressed. This comprehensively updated report discusses the difference between cosmetic damage and structural damage resulting from soil shrinkage or heave movement and provides information on both prevention and mitigation of damage. Topics include definition and characteristics of expansive soils; building foundation types; causes of interior and exterior cracks; climate, vegetation, and landscape irrigation; homeowner maintenance; lot drainage and foundation performance; and prevention and mitigation techniques. Numerous new photographs and updated diagrams and figures illustrate key points. Also included is a section of frequently asked questions by individuals who have or are building homes on expansive soils. This book will be of interest to homeowners, as well as construction industry professionals and engineering practitioners.
